MYALL LAKES ENCOURAGED TO CELEBRATE LOCAL SENIORS

Posted December 5th, 2024

Tanya Thompson, Member for Myall Lakes is encouraging residents to celebrate the positive role seniors play in the community by nominating them for the 2025 NSW Seniors Festival Local Achievement Awards.

Mrs Thompson said the festival and the awards acknowledge the contributions and achievements of seniors.

“If you know a senior who makes a difference in our community, I encourage you to nominate them for their efforts,” Mrs Thompson said.

“This annual festival is all about celebrating our older residents and our community is filled with incredible seniors who deserve recognition.”

Nominations are now open for the awards program, one of many initiatives the NSW Government promotes to support the state’s seniors living happy, healthy, and active lives.

Winners of the Local Achievement Awards will be announced during the Myall Lakes 2025 Seniors Concerts on the 10th and 11th March 2025.

The awards program is part of an exciting schedule of events across the state.
